Asphalt roof leak repair services involve identifying and addressing areas where water has penetrated or is likely to penetrate the roofing system. Skilled contractors typically perform thorough inspections to locate leaks, which may be caused by damaged or missing shingles, cracks in the asphalt surface, or compromised flashing. Once the source of the leak is identified, repairs often include replacing damaged shingles, sealing cracks, and reinforcing vulnerable areas to prevent further water intrusion. This process helps maintain the integrity of the roof and protects the underlying structure from water damage.
Leaks in asphalt roofs can lead to a range of problems if left unaddressed, including water stains on ceilings,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Persistent leaks may also cause interior damage, such as warped ceilings, stained walls, and compromised insulation. Repair services aim to eliminate these issues by stopping leaks at their source, which can ext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ent costly future repairs. Timely intervention can also reduce the risk of interior damage and maintain the overall safety and value of the property.

Cost Range for Leak Repair - The typical cost for asphalt roof leak repairs can vary from $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of the damage. Smaller repairs, such as patching a minor leak, may cost closer to $300, while larger repairs could approach $1,200 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s depend on the size of the leak, roof accessibility, and the materials needed for repair. For example, fixing a small leak in a standard residential roof might cost around $400, whereas extensive damage could increase the price significantly.
Average Service Pricing - On average, homeowners in Clackamas County can expect to pay between $500 and $1,000 for asphalt roof leak repairs. This range covers typical patching, sealing, or minor repairs performed by local service providers.
Additional Expenses - Costs may also include inspection fees or minor preparatory work, which can add $50 to $150 to the overall expense. It is advisable to cont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ific roof con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my asphalt roof has a leak? Signs of a roof leak include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ged shingles, and the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ice any of these, contacting a local roofing professional is recommended.
What causes asphalt roof leaks? Common causes include damaged or missing shingles, aging roofing materials, poor installation, and severe weather conditions such as heavy rain or hail.
Can a roof leak be repaired without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many roof leaks can be repaired with targeted fixes like sealing damaged areas or replacing damaged shingles, depending on the extent of the damage.
How long does asphalt roof leak repair typically take? The duration varies based on the size and complexity of the leak,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day by local roofing contractors.
